About Raphael Bertani

Raphael Bertani is a scholar working on Neurology, Epidemiology, Surgery,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and Genetics, having authored 83 papers that have together received 197 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Meningioma and schwannoma management (21 papers), Intracranial Aneurysms: Treatment and Complications (20 papers), Vascular Malformations Diagnosis and Treatment (16 papers), Traumatic Brain Injury and Neurovascular Disturbances (16 papers), Cerebrospinal fluid and hydrocephalus (14 papers), Glioma Diagnosis and Treatment (12 papers), Intracerebral and Subarachnoid Hemorrhage Research (7 papers) and Cerebrovascular and Carotid Artery Diseases (7 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Neurology (97 citations), Health Informatics (6 citations), Internal Medicine (8 citations),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ience (29 citations) and Genetics (16 citations). Raphael Bertani has collaborated with scholars based in Brazil, United States and Peru. Frequent co-authors include Stefan W. Koester, Wellingson Silva Paiva, Eberval Gadelha Figueiredo‬‬‬, Leonardo C. Welling, Ní­collas Nunes Rabelo, Eberval Gadelha Figueiredo, Bruno Lima Pessôa, Sérgio Brasil, Steven Roth and Sebastião Gusmão. Their work appears in journals such as World Neurosurgery, Neurosurgical Review, Neurosurgery, Clinical Neurology and Neurosurgery and Journal of Neuro-Oncology.
